Policy and Purpose The distribution and sale of new motor vehicles in this State vitally affects the general economy of the State and the public interest and welfare of its citizens. It is the policy of this State and the purpose of this Act to exercise the State’s police power to insure a sound system of distrib- uting and selling new motor vehicles through licensing and regulating the manufacturers, distributors, and franchised dealers of those vehicles to provide for compliance with manufacturer’s warranties, and to prevent frauds, unfair practices, discriminations, impositions, and other abuses of our citizens. 3 tex. occ. code ann. § 2301.002(23) (Vernon’s Supp. 2017). 4 Id. Subchapter I, §§ 2301.401 - 2301.406. This Subchapter requires a manufacturer or distributor to fairly and adequately compensate its dealers for warranty work. In addition, the agency may request a copy of the require- ments that a manufacturer or distributor imposes on its dealers with respect to warranty repair duties and vehicle and delivery obligations. 5 Act of June 19, 1983, 68th Leg.
